What Are the Functions of Tyres?

Must Read
  • The most important and effective functions of tyres are to support and distribute vehicle weight, and proper distribution of appropriate vehicle loads on all four tyres are key for improving driving safety and vehicle performance. Tyres also aid instability, allowing you to easily shift directions.
  • Because of the tyres’ unique rubber compound, they are flexible, allowing you to ride in comfort and convenience regardless of road or weather conditions. They are primarily responsible for the vehicle’s cornering acceleration and braking systems, as well as improving fuel efficiency and road rolling resistance.

Radial Tyres

Radical tyres have elongated cords that can stretch up to 90 degrees from the tyre’s centre from bead to bead. One of the key advantages of radial Functions of Tyres is that they distribute pressure evenly. Radical tyres also feature a lower soil penetration, making them more environmentally friendly. These tyres also offer better vehicle handling and stability, are puncture-resistant, and offer better traction control. They are a very cost-effective choice because they last a long period and wear evenly.

Tubeless Tyres

Tubeless tyres don’t even have an inner tube, but they do have a designed internal liner. The tubeless tyres reduce air leakage by creating an airtight seal between the rim and the tyre. Tubeless tyres are more expensive, but they have a lot of benefits. Tubeless tyres deflate slowly, reducing the chance of losing control over time. And tubeless tyres Tyres acton round reduce the weight of your wheel assembly, improving performance and comfort. Tubeless tyres lack an inner tube, resulting in less friction and, as a result, longer tyre life.

All-Terrain Tyres

All-terrain tyres can be utilized both on and off the road. These tyres have aggressive and durable characteristics to fulfil the demands of difficult situations. On wet and snowy areas, as well as on the road, all terrains give outstanding traction. Circular grooves in all-terrain tyres work wonders on any uneven terrain. All-terrain tyres are perfect for truck, SUV, and other vehicle drivers that need extra protection in a range of circumstances.

Performance Tyres

Performance tyres are self-explanatory; they are high-performance tyres made for sports cars and other high-performance vehicles. Drivers who desire a sporty look and high-speed performance should go for performance tyres. They also offer excellent traction in both dry and rainy circumstances, as well as long-term durability. Performance tyres are built with grooves that allow the vehicle to maintain decent control. There are three-speed ratings available for these tyres: ordinary performance, high performance, and ultra-high performance.

SUV Tyres

SUV tyres are engineered with cutting-edge technology to provide the best blend of comfort, look, and function for your vehicle. Because SUV tyres can withstand more loads, they have an increased load index than standard tyres. SUV tyres are exceptionally cost-effective since they are more durable than other types of tyres and can be used in any type of road condition.

Run Flat Tyres  

Run-flat tyres have innovative sidewalls and are (also known as self-supporting tyres) are strengthened and fortified. Run-flat tyres feature stiff rubber inserts that assist your car maintains its weight after a puncture. They’re made to withstand lateral and diagonal loads on the car even if the tyre pressure is low, allowing you to travel a given distance.
